But whoso looketh into the perfect law of liberty, and continueth therein, he being not a forgetful hearer, but a doer of the work, this man shall be blessed in his deed. James 1:25

The MSG rendering of our opening text says,

But whoever catches a glimpse of the revealed counsel of God–the free life!-even out of the corner of his eye, and sticks with it, is no distracted scatterbrain but a man or woman of action. That person will find delight and affirmation in the action. 

The word vision refers to the redemptive revelation of Christ. Proverbs 29:18 (AMP) says,

Where there is no vision [no redemptive revelation of God], the people perish; but he who keeps the law [of God, which includes that of man]–blessed (happy, fortunate, and enviable) is he. 

The above text shows that your ability to live is by first developing a vision. Any man without a vision is as dead as he is alive. Developing a vision is the start point of a man’s success. You can never be successful without a vision.

Take a look at the Eagle. When it wants to get a prey the first thing it goes after is his vision (sight). This is because it knows that if the vision is destroyed, the prey is his. This is the same technique the devil uses. He would do all he can to cripple your vision because he knows that once he gets your vision, he has a hold over your entire life.

Your vision (realistic vision) propels you for success.

Habakkuk 2:2 says,

And the LORD answered me, and said, Write the vision, and make [it] plain upon tables, that he may run that readeth it. 

As you develop your vision, be sure to make it plain enough. You then have a responsibility to add value to your vision.

Your environment as well as your disposition about your vision would help you add value to it. If your environment depicts unproductivity, you would be able to add little or no value to your vision. Create the right environment for you vision to be well developed.

Start developing your vision; it is your life.

DECLARATION:
I develop my vision daily, as I look into the perfect law of liberty. I am running with it.


SCRIPTURAL REFERENCE:
Genesis 41:13-57, Habakkuk 2:2-3
